Summary

It’s time to stop second-guessing yourself and start building the qualities that will make you an authentic, amazing leader.

In the past century, women have scaled new heights in the workplace.

From working as clerks and secretaries in the 1950s, women today are now holding top positions in the world’s largest corporations.

Yet, women remain vastly underrepresented in leadership roles, making up only five percent of Fortune 500 CEOs, and 10 percent of top management positions in S&P 1500 companies, despite accounting for 47 percent of the labor workforce.

The reason for this has nothing to do with intelligence, skills, or personality.

You might be one of these women—wanting to achieve more and reach the top of your career, but you can’t get out of your own way! Or you keep letting insecurities get in the way.

But you don’t have to let fears and self-doubt keep you from your ambitions.

If you want to be a leader, you can be one, regardless of your gender, social status, educational background, or current position.

You can have a family and be a leader. You can be single and be a leader. You can have any religious, political, or sexual preference and still excel at being the driving force of a team.

What it takes is essential preparation, which will give you the confidence to go for your goals and become the leader you’re meant to be.
